The Evolution of Game Mechanics: From Basic Rules to Complex Systems
Historically, early video games relied on straightforward mechanics—think of Pac-Man’s simple maze navigation or the block stacking of Tetris. Over time, these principles have matured into intricate systems blending chance, skill, and narrative progression. Modern titles often incorporate layered mechanics that deepen engagement, such as procedural generation, adaptive AI, and monetisation algorithms.
This evolution has prompted industry analysts to examine how game mechanics influence player retention, monetisation strategies, and overall game longevity. The rising sophistication invites a closer look into the frameworks that underpin successful gaming experiences today.

Case Studies: Successes Rooted in Robust Mechanics
| Title | Key Feature | Metrics of Success |
|---|---|---|
| Fortnite | Dynamic building mechanics combined with real-time engagement | Over 350 million players worldwide, high retention rates, frequent updates |
| Genshin Impact | Open-world exploration with gacha mechanics integrated seamlessly | Revenue exceeding $3 billion within two years, active player base expansion |
| Among Us | Social deduction mechanics fostering community interaction | Spike in popularity during global lockdowns, active monthly players averaging 60 million |
